Stone Age

英 [stəʊn eɪdʒ]

美 [stoʊn eɪdʒ]

n.  石器时代

牛津词典

    noun

    • 石器时代
      the very early period of human history when tools and weapons were made of stone
      1. My dad's taste in music is from the Stone Age (= very old-fashioned) .
        我老爸的音乐品味都老得掉渣了。

    柯林斯词典

    • 石器时代
      The Stone Ageis a very early period of human history, when people used tools and weapons made of stone, not metal.
